“It was supposed to be life after being labeled as the villain, but…aren’t the heroines’ favorabilities a bit strange?”

Ryuoin Taketo, born into a wealthy family, mistakenly believed himself to be a special existence and caused trouble from kindergarten to middle school.

However, in an academy where one can progress from elementary to university via an escalator system, he was condemned during middle school by a new male student, leading him to become a loner at school.

After being defeated, Taketo’s family disowned him, and in shock, this novel’s protagonist reincarnated into the bedridden Taketo.

But rather than that, what’s more painful is the cringeworthy episodes flowing from Taketo’s memories.

Anyway, he doesn’t want to be bullied in high school, so he intends to live quietly and peacefully.

Despite thinking that way, the heroines keep getting close to him.

The biggest issue I have with this story is the number of times it retells the same event from an alternate character's point of view. I haven't counted, but I would guess that fully 1/3 of the content is this type of narrative. Sometimes it adds good context, but often it just states information that was relatively easy to infer on your own.

It's pretty standard harem wish fulfillment, except that the protagonist is actually highly competent (and I think he's supposed to be attractive too). It does try to have... more>> its cake and eat it too by circumstantially making the protagonist the underdog, even though he's superior to any of his rivals who have popped up thus far. His only real flaw is that he's kind of a well-intentioned jerk (offering genuinely helpful advice as criticism, having high expectations of others, etc). The translation is average to slightly above average, but if you've ever read a MTL story, you won't have any issues with that aspect.

Overall though, I think it's fine. It's nowhere near the best thing that I'm reading, but I'm also willing to keep reading it for now. <<less
